    I don't know for sure. It will certainly depend on things that are unknown for us atm. IMO it will depend on the purchase rate. If all expected users to buy the software already had bought it and no extra money is getting into ISI's bank account, what do you think it will happen? Would you work for nothing? If ISI has no clear project regarding timeline, how are they supposed to get the money required for further development?

    A project needs to have a expected budget for development and also a expected number of buyers for the product. With that data you can fix the price of the product to be sold.

    Everybody says ISI is a small team. What is small? 10?, 20?, 30 people? If you consider an average cost of 40.000 $ per person and year and a 4 year development that would make 3,200,000$ budget for 20 people. Considering an average price of 60 $ they would need to sell more than 50.000 copies of rf2 to avoid bankruptcy. These numbers are for sure a wild guess and lots of things are not included as licenses hardware, rentals.... What I mean is that some projects just fail due to bad planification and I hope it is not the case but some people just think life is wonderful and that ISI has no risks in this project. That is not true and the way the project is being carried doesn't seem to be the expected one. Unfortunately for everybody there are not those many simracers as arcade game players in Playstation or Xbox which could support such a long development as rfactor2 seems to need. I dont know how many people are working in polyphony digital for GT series but for sure the expected number of copies to be sold are in another magnitude compared to rf2. In other games as fifa they release one game every year. Either some are making lots of money or others might have the risk of failing in the try.

    Finally, saying that rf2 is almost bug free atm is ridiculous. Lots of things are not implemented yet and optimization certainly sucks. Graphics are from the past. Certainly a lot of work stilk to be done.
